The Beatles: A Musical Biography by Kate Siobhan Mulligan

This in-depth, research-based book profiles the band that shaped a generation and changed the face of music forever.

What makes a legend? The Beatles: A Musical Biography attempts to answer that question by taking an in-depth look at the band that changed pop music. Examining the events and ideas that influenced each album and many songs, the book seeks to explain what drove the Beatles to make music, as well as what drove the music itself.

While the biography covers the musical history and achievements of the band, it also looks at what was happening in the lives of John, Paul, George, and Ringo during the Beatle years, exploring their personal drives and aspirations and their relationships with each other. Readers will come away from this book with a far better appreciation of the Lads from Liverpooland of what was really going on underneath those oh-so-controversial haircuts.


  • Ten original photos depict the Beatles from their humble beginnings to the height of their success
  • An epilogue discusses the period after the breakup
  • A timeline features major events and achievements of the Beatles
  • Includes discographies of singles and albums and a list of awards

About Kate Siobhan Mulligan

Kate Siobhan Mulligan is a freelance writer from Vancouver, Canada, with a BFA in creative writing from the University of British Columbia.
